Dennis Andrew (Denny) Wolfe, 63, of New Ringgold, passed away suddenly on Wednesday, August 22nd, at Assateague Island National Seashore, Chincoteague VA while vacationing with his beloved wife Kathy.
His family is comforted in knowing that Denny spent his final hours in his "happy place" with his feet in the wet sand while looking at the ocean; the scene he shared with his family many times. The entire Wolfe family would like to thank the Chincoteague community, especially the rescue groups, that were so unbelievably helpful.
Dennis was born on December 20, 1954, a son of Joy Aldine (Rolland) Wolfe, of Orwigsburg, PA and the late Robert C. F. Wolfe.
He was the husband of Kathleen (Kathy) Susan (Orlosky) Wolfe, and they celebrated their 38th wedding anniversary in May.
Denny was a 1972 graduate of Blue Mountain High School and a 1976 graduate of the Pennsylvania State University, State College. During college breaks Denny worked at Tuscarora State Park as a lifeguard. He started his career as the Accounting Manager at Rest Haven Nursing Home. He was also the Controller at Diakon Lutheran Services (formerly the Lutheran Home of Topton), Mechanicsburg and most recently before his retirement, was the Controller at Berkshire Health Partners, Wyomissing.
Denny had a big heart and loved his family dearly; always putting others before himself. He was an avid OAKLAND Raiders and PSU Nittany Lions Fan. Since his retirement, Denny enjoyed experimenting in the kitchen to the surprise and fulfillment of others.
In addition to his wife, Kathy, and mother Joy, Denny is survived by his son, Drew Wolfe, husband of Victoria Rodriguez-Wolfe; daughter, Kelly Wolfe; brother, Scott Wolfe, husband of Marci Schatzman; sister, Wendy, wife of Robert Schuld, I.; grandchildren: Destiny Umberger; Kobe Wilson; and Harper Wolfe; aunts and uncles, and his many nieces, nephews and cousins.
